Handover Note — Pricing, the Loomfield Product Line

Branch managers: as Director Haskell hands the Loomfield line to me, a quick pricing recap. We're holding list prices through next quarter but tightening discount authority — anything past 12% now needs regional sign-off. The Loomfield Plus tier gets a modest uplift at relaunch. Questions to me from here on. The confidential business-plan note is below.

management briefing: Project Ulavan slips by two quarters because of the staffing delay.

- [ ] **Step 7: Breaker override escrow.** After sealing the signing keys for the Tallgrove upstream API circuit breaker, confirm the support team can force the breaker open during a full outage. The override bundle lives in the sealed escrow drawer and is useless without its unlock phrase. Two ceremony witnesses must initial this step before proceeding. The escrow bundle is decrypted with the recovery passphrase that follows.

vault phrase of kahip-kahop = holath-quenmir

# Artifact Signing — Chronoweave Timetable Solver

For this week's eng sync: all Chronoweave solver builds must be signed before upload to the Lantermill artifact store. The CI stage verifies the digest, signs the tarball, and attaches provenance metadata. Unsigned artifacts are rejected at promotion. Rotation happens quarterly; verify fingerprints against the wiki. The current signing key used by the pipeline is below.

rollout seal: bky4_x7Gc

## Configuration: Role-Based Access

Quillpad enforces three roles — reader, editor, steward — resolved at request time from the session claims. Set `RBAC_DEFAULT_ROLE=reader` so unauthenticated visitors never gain write access, and keep `RBAC_STRICT=true` in production. Role mappings live in roles.yaml, not the env file. The claims verifier needs its signing secret defined on the next line:

sealed setting: RELAY_SECRET13=bca49b02a6971